'Ozil levels of hype' - Arsenal fans go nuts as Edu makes Martin Odegaard transfer move

Arsenal are in the market for additions before the January transfer window closes in less than two weeks and a creative midfielder is top of the agenda.

The Gunners have struggled to create chances in the final third this season, though have seen a recent boost following Emile Smith Rowe's excellent rise.

While Mesut Ozil has been an outcast in the squad post-lockdown last year, his imminent exit has truly handled the mantle down to the next figure to pull the strings in Mikel Arteta's squad.

Smith Rowe has shown plenty of potential and the signs are promising but relying on him too quickly could be a mistake, hence why new additions are being considered.

Mikel Arteta on Emile Smith Rowe and Bukayo Saka's influence

According to Sky Sports, Real Madrid's Martin Odegaard is among them and it's reported that Arsenal have made an approach to land the 22-year-old playmaker.

The Denmark international shone on loan with Real Sociedad last season, who are the favourites to secure his services once again.

Odegaard has requested to leave Madrid this month following limited opportunities, playing just five minutes of football since the start of December.

Whilst beating Sociedad to a deal will be a tough task, with it already indicated negotiations are at an advanced stage, many Arsenal fans believe their club should make a move.

If the Gunners were to pull off a move, it would see them utilise the relationship with Los Blancos that blossomed with the deals for Dani Ceballos.
